AI软件直线分割:高效图像处理的利器及应用详解141


在图像处理领域,直线分割是一项基础且重要的任务,它广泛应用于各种场景,例如文档扫描、医学图像分析、自动驾驶等。传统的直线分割方法依赖于复杂的算法和大量的计算资源,效率较低且精度难以保证。然而,随着人工智能技术的飞速发展,AI软件在直线分割方面展现出了巨大的优势,其高效性、准确性和便捷性为图像处理带来了革命性的变化。

本文将深入探讨AI软件在直线分割方面的应用,涵盖其核心技术、不同AI模型的优缺点、以及在实际应用中的案例分析。我们将了解如何利用AI软件快速、准确地完成图像的直线分割任务,并提升工作效率。

一、AI软件直线分割的核心技术

AI软件实现直线分割主要依靠深度学习技术,特别是卷积神经网络(CNN)和循环神经网络(RNN)。这些神经网络能够学习图像中的特征,并根据这些特征识别和分割直线。具体来说,常用的方法包括:

1. 基于边缘检测的直线分割: 这类方法首先利用边缘检测算法(如Canny算子)提取图像边缘信息,然后通过霍夫变换或RANSAC算法拟合直线。AI软件可以利用深度学习模型对边缘检测进行优化,提高边缘提取的精度和鲁棒性,从而提升直线分割的准确率。这种方法对图像噪声比较敏感,在图像质量较差的情况下效果可能不佳。

2. 基于语义分割的直线分割: 这种方法将直线分割问题转化为语义分割问题,即对图像中的每个像素进行分类,判断其是否属于直线。通过训练一个深度学习模型,例如U-Net或Mask R-CNN,可以有效地识别和分割图像中的直线,即使在复杂的背景下也能取得较好的效果。这种方法能够更好地处理复杂的图像场景,鲁棒性更强。

3. 基于深度学习的直线检测: 一些深度学习模型专门用于直线检测,例如LSD (Line Segment Detector)及其改进版本。这些模型可以直接输出图像中的直线段信息,无需额外的后处理步骤。这类方法通常速度较快,但对直线形状和方向的表达能力可能不如语义分割方法。

二、不同AI模型的优缺点比较

不同的AI模型在直线分割任务中具有不同的优缺点,选择合适的模型需要根据具体应用场景和数据特点进行权衡。例如:

1. U-Net: U-Net模型具有强大的语义分割能力,能够有效地识别和分割图像中的直线,即使在复杂的背景下也能取得较好的效果。但是,U-Net模型的计算量较大,训练时间较长。

2. Mask R-CNN: Mask R-CNN模型不仅能够检测出直线,还能精确地分割出直线的像素区域。它具有较高的精度,但计算量更大,训练时间更长。

3. LSD: LSD模型速度快,效率高,但对噪声比较敏感,精度可能不如基于语义分割的方法。

选择合适的AI模型需要考虑精度、速度、计算资源等因素。如果对精度要求较高,可以选择U-Net或Mask R-CNN;如果对速度要求较高,可以选择LSD或其他轻量级模型。

三、AI软件直线分割的应用案例

AI软件直线分割技术在许多领域都有广泛的应用,例如:

1. 文档扫描: AI软件可以自动识别和分割文档中的直线,从而进行图像矫正和文字识别,提高文档处理效率。

2. 医学图像分析: 在医学图像分析中,AI软件可以自动分割医学图像中的血管、神经等线性结构,辅助医生进行诊断和治疗。

3. 自动驾驶: 自动驾驶系统需要识别道路上的车道线和交通标志线,AI软件可以快速准确地分割出这些直线,保证驾驶安全。

4. 机器视觉: 在工业自动化领域,AI软件可以用于检测产品缺陷、测量零件尺寸等,提高生产效率和产品质量。

5. 地理信息系统(GIS): AI软件可以用于处理卫星图像,提取道路、河流等线性特征,用于地图绘制和地理信息分析。

四、未来发展趋势

随着人工智能技术的不断发展,AI软件直线分割技术也将不断进步。未来的发展趋势包括:

1. 更高的精度和鲁棒性: 未来的AI模型将能够更好地处理复杂的图像场景,在噪声、光照变化等情况下也能保持较高的精度和鲁棒性。

2. 更快的速度和效率: 未来的AI模型将更加轻量化,能够在资源受限的设备上运行,提高处理速度和效率。

3. 更广泛的应用: AI软件直线分割技术将在更多领域得到应用,例如虚拟现实、增强现实、艺术创作等。

总而言之,AI软件直线分割技术为图像处理带来了革命性的变化,其高效性、准确性和便捷性为各行各业带来了巨大的价值。随着技术的不断发展,AI软件直线分割技术将在未来发挥更加重要的作用。

2025-05-27


上一篇:AI提取重点软件:高效学习与办公的利器

下一篇:AI看图纸神器:提升效率的革命性工具